Quatre hommes aux poings nus brings a gritty, raw energy that’s hard to ignore. The atmosphere feels thick with desperation as these four crew members hold tight to their dreams of profit, only to discover that their catch is far from ordinary. It's not just a fishing tale; it dives into themes of greed and survival with a haunting undertone. The practical effects used here lend a tactile quality to the film, making the eerie moments hit harder. While the pacing might feel a bit uneven at times, it actually amplifies that sense of dread. The performances carry a weight that makes you feel the stakes, and there’s a certain charm in its unpredictability that keeps you engaged.
